Spanish vs Celtic Seniors Poverty Over the Age of 75 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 416,617,301 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Spanish and poverty level among seniors over the age of 75 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.627 and weighted average of 11.8%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 167,925,016 people shows a poor positive correlation between the proportion of Celtics and poverty level among seniors over the age of 75 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.183 and weighted average of 11.0%, a difference of 7.4%.
